Output 6dd7d0e23a2c31eb8ff13220ce1d2cd2c090f4d8aaf54ebb0529cc2596fb38ab:92

value
102162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6603105253c1d7faa986b7e93feb3a1238535fac OP_EQUAL
address
3AzQWz2L47QQdNbdjwrcQXrR1NwPGMxZoe
transaction
6dd7d0e23a2c31eb8ff13220ce1d2cd2c090f4d8aaf54ebb0529cc2596fb38ab
spent
true